Caring for Our Loved Ones

It’s always a difficult decision whether to place a member of your family in a long-term care center or nursing home, as we are essentially entrusting strangers with the comfort and care of our loved ones when they are at their most vulnerable.

Even with the best caregivers, many nursing homes are overcrowded and understaffed, by design, in an attempt to save money and maximize profit, resulting in inadequate care, sometimes ending in avoidable fatalities.

Neglect at a long-term care facility comes in many forms such as malnutrition, dehydration, infections, bedsores, medication errors, falls, fractures, and failures to monitor the patient’s well-being.
